Oh wow, I just installed "Starlight" for the new V2.2 - it's a heck of a lot more than just a skin:
- When defocussed, floater windows, have a near-invisible background
- Sidebar reduced in size, becomes possible to drag, and does not slide the chiclets/buttons along the bottom bar (note: this is not changeable to crop the world view)
- Better formatting of tabbed IM window (tabs larger and no icons in them)
- Reformatted Profile panels for your own and other profiles
- Three additional Preferences panels
- Several UI components made semi-transparent
- "About Land" Button added to Navigation Bar
- Draw Distance slider added to Navigation Bar (between 32 and 512 metres)
- Options added to the menu ('XStreet', 'Grid Status', 'My Uploads', 'My Useful Features')
- "Inventory" Button added to bottom bar
- Resize marker for bottom bar to make it more obvious (from Kirstens Viewer)
- Camera control made smaller than the standard version (similar to the Kirstens Viewer approach but smaller)
- Minor tweaks to the skinning and usability (resizing columns, increasing glow, realigning text etc.)
- Special, lighter Black & Orange look (with several changes to colours and widgets)

Antialiasing wasn't working for me on this release, even after rebooting and relogging. I was not liking the jaggies!
I went to my NVIDIA Control Panel and found a setting to "overide application settings" for antialiasing. This works perfectly, SL actually looks even better than it did before. I think my video card does a better job of antialiasing. I'm really glad I discovered this
